Ingredients
To create a delicious sautéed dish of carrots and peas, you’ll need the following ingredients:
Ingredient | Quantity |
---|---|
Fresh Carrots | 2 medium, sliced |
Fresh or Frozen Peas | 1 cup |
Olive Oil or Butter | 2 tablespoons |
Garlic (optional) | 2 cloves, minced |
Salt and Pepper | To taste |
Fresh Herbs | For garnish |

Preparing the Vegetables
Before you start sautéing, it’s important to properly prepare your vegetables. Here’s how:
How to Peel and Slice Carrots
- Start by rinsing the carrots under cold water to remove any dirt.
- Using a vegetable peeler, remove the outer skin of the carrots.
- Once peeled, slice the carrots diagonally into thin rounds for even cooking.
How to Rinse and Prepare Peas
- If using fresh peas, shell them by gently pressing on the pods to release the peas.
- Rinse the peas under cold water and set aside.
- If using frozen peas, simply measure them out; no further preparation is needed.
Tips for Using Frozen Peas: Frozen peas can be added directly to the pan without thawing. They cook quickly and maintain their bright green color when sautéed properly.
Sautéing Technique
Now that your ingredients are ready, let’s dive into the sautéing process:
- Heat the skillet: Place your large skillet over medium heat.
- Add fat: Pour in the olive oil or butter and allow it to melt, coating the bottom of the pan.
- Incorporate garlic: If you’re using garlic, add the minced cloves to the pan and sauté for about 30 seconds, or until fragrant.
- Add carrots: Introduce the sliced carrots to the pan. Sauté for about 4-5 minutes, or until they start to become slightly tender.
- Introduce peas: Add the peas to the skillet along with salt and pepper to taste. Stir well to combine.
- Finish cooking: Sauté the mixture for another 3-4 minutes, or until the peas are heated through and the carrots are tender yet firm.
Tips for Perfectly Sautéed Carrots and Peas
To achieve the best results with your sautéed carrots and peas, consider the following tips:
- Timing and Temperature: Ensure your skillet is hot enough before adding the vegetables. This helps in achieving a nice sear and retaining the vibrant colors.
- Avoid Overcrowding: If you’re making a larger batch, consider sautéing in batches to avoid steaming the vegetables.
- Vibrant Colors: Sauté until just tender to maintain the bright colors of the vegetables. Overcooked veggies can lose their appeal.
- Variations: Feel free to add other vegetables like bell peppers, onions, or even zucchini for a more colorful medley.
